There will only be 3 hatchlings pictured from this point since I unfortunately ended up losing one of the hatchlings that was a beautiful little yellow belly. It had a completely mangled and twisted umbilical cord and didn't absorb ANY of the yolk at all. I went ahead and went through with the normal twisted umbilicus procedure and tied off the cord and snipped off the yolk. After that I left him alone and when I came back to check on him he had passed away...very very sad and I hate that I lost that hatchling but I did all I could to save the little one...

I will once they shed ;)
Keep in mind you pick some pretty hard stuff especially when you have two highlighter morphs like fire and YB (YB in combination with all the other stuff becomes hardly possible to tell)
Your issue identifying is not unique trust me the more gene in an animal (especially certain genes) the harder it becomes and sometimes the real ID only happens when you breed the animal as you can miss one gene.
